单词 jealousness
释义

jealousnessn.

Brit. /ˈdʒɛləsnəs/, U.S. /ˈdʒɛləsnəs/
Etymology: < jealous adj. + -ness suffix.
Now rare.
The quality of being jealous; jealousy; suspicion.

c1380 Eng. Wycliffite Serm. in Sel. Wks. I. 88 Chana, þat is gelousnes.
a1382 Bible (Wycliffite, E.V.) (Douce 369(1)) (1850) Song of Sol. viii. 6 Strong is as deth looue, hard as helle ielousnesse.
1382 Bible (Wycliffite, E.V.) Num. v. 15 If the spiryt of gelousnes stire the man aȝens his wijf.
c1475 (?c1425) Avowing of King Arthur (1984) l. 1005 Of ielusnes, be þou bold, Thine avow may þou hold.
a1626 F. Bacon Considerations War with Spain in Harl. Misc. (Malh.) IV. 135 Not out of umbrages, light jealousness, apprehensions afar off, but out of clear foresight of imminent danger.
1900 Longman's Mag. June 141 Jealousness does not seem to be the distinguishing feature of Louise's early training.
